HOW TO NAVIGATE A RELATIONSHIP BREAKUP AT WORK WITHOUT ALIENATING YOUR COWORKERS

2 min read Lesbian

When it comes to breaking up with a partner, it can be difficult to determine how one's coworkers will react. While some may offer support and understanding, others may feel uncomfortable discussing such personal matters in the workplace. It is important to remember that each person's reaction will vary based on their own beliefs and experiences.

There are certain ways to handle this situation professionally and respectfully. Here are some tips for navigating the aftermath of a relationship breakup within the office:

1. Be mindful of your body language and tone. Even if you do not want to talk about the breakup, your colleagues will likely notice changes in your mood or behavior. Try to maintain a professional attitude and demeanor while still being honest and open.

2. Keep communication lines open. If possible, try to remain friendly and cordial with your ex-partner while at work. This will help avoid awkwardness and tension among coworkers.

Don't go out of your way to interact with them unnecessarily.

3. Maintain confidentiality. Don't share too many details about your breakup with coworkers unless you are comfortable doing so. Respect their privacy as well.

4. Take care of yourself first. Breakups can be emotionally taxing, so make sure you take time to process your feelings before returning to work. Talk to friends or family members who can provide support during this difficult time.

5. Consider taking a leave of absence. If the breakup has left you feeling overwhelmed or unable to focus at work, consider requesting a short leave of absence from your employer. This will allow you to take some time to recover without worrying about appearing unprofessional.

By following these guidelines, you can navigate the aftermath of a relationship ending in the workplace with grace and professionalism. Remember that each situation is unique and there is no one-size-fits-all solution. The most important thing is to prioritize your own mental health and wellbeing above all else.

How do colleagues respond to the aftermath of a relationship ending within the workplace?

When a romantic relationship ends between two coworkers, it can have significant repercussions on their professional relationships. Colleagues may feel uncomfortable or uncertain about how to navigate the situation, particularly if they were close with both parties involved. Some may avoid one or both individuals altogether out of discomfort or fear of saying or doing something wrong. Others might try to remain neutral but still struggle with feelings of awkwardness.
